I know the title sounds kind of stupid, but I just installed a big 16g on my car yesterday night and I can't tell any differences between that and the 14b. :barf: I'm fixing to install a boost gauge and a Denzo (sp) fuel pump this weekend. Everything right now is stock on my car, but should I be able to feel any differences in power over the 14b at stock boost levels?? If I should then maybe I do have boost leak problems. Give me some advice guys, thanks.
 
You cant just slap on a bigger turbo and expect to go fast, you need all the supporting mods. With a b16g you are going to need a bigger fuel pump and maybe even a air/fuel controller. I cant believe you dont even have a boost gauge or data logger, they should be your first mods

You won't notice too many differences, if any at all, until you get it tuned. The turbos aren't extremely different in size, so until you get some more fuel mods and a good tune, you won;t notice it too much.
